一般来说,最常见的HTTP服务器有IISApache,例如软件生活用的LAMP服务器其实就是Linux+Apache+Mysql+PHP的缩写。除此之外,还有很多轻量的HTTP服务器软件。

简单地说,和上面的两个相比,这些服务器软件拥有优异的性能表现来承担更大的负载,这对于大型网站来说至关重要,因为往往就能节省大量的成本。

早期我知道有个lighttpd很不错,现在依然有很多大型网站使用着。不过自从nginx出来之后,凭着更优异的性能,欲来越多网站开始使用了。

nginx是俄罗斯人Igor Sysoev的作品,这种软件一般都是运行在非Windows上面的,所以官方下载回来的压缩包里面是找不到exe文件的。

不过还是有人提供了编译好的Win32版本。如果你只是和我一样想玩玩这个被世界上知名大型网站用的HTTP服务器软件,那么可以下回来玩玩,真正的使用的话还是推荐在*nux的环境下。

下载回来解压到C盘nigux下面,注意一定要放在这个目录,如果实在不想放这里的话需要自己修改里面的相关参数,否则是不能正常使用的。

然后运行Start-nginx就可以了,这时你打开浏览器输入http://127.0.0.1就可以看到了。

软件生活 AppLife.Net

这个是默认的首页,你可以在C:\nginx\html找到并修改。另外,logs存放着访问记录,conf存放着各种的配置文件。

至于更高级的玩法我也没研究了,不过我猜测应该和其他版本一样,所以可以到官方看看wikimailling list吧。

 

DOCUMENTATION:
This README is intended to get you up and running. For more in-depth documentation please see http://nginx.net

GETTING STARTED:
If viewing this from the installer, you can start nginx from the next screen.
Otherwise: to run nginx, simply go to START-->Programs-->nginx-->Start nginx.
You may also use the quick launch icon or desktop icon if you installed them.

STOPPING THE SERVICE:
START-->Programs-->nginx-->Stop nginx is the easiest method.
You may also use the quick launch icon or desktop icon if you installed them.

UNINSTALLING:
To uninstall everything, back up your html folder, your nginx.conf, and everything else within the nginx directory that you might want. Stop nginx. Then click 'Uninstall nginx' from the Start Menu or double-click Unins000.exe from the main nginx directory.

DOWNLOAD:
The latest Windows version is at:
http://www.kevinworthington.com/nginx/

ANNOUNCEMENTS:
nginx for Windows announcements and information is at:
http://www.kevinworthington.com/index.php/category/computers/nginx/

Wiki:
The nginx wiki is a good place to get help and tips:
http://wiki.codemongers.com/Main

CONTACT:
For any information or comments specific to this Windows port of nginx, please contact:
Kevin Worthington: <kworthington at gmail dot com>
Please put nginx in the subject.
For anything else related to nginx, please visit http://nginx.net/
Thank you.

%Changelog
* Mon Jul 07 2008 Kevin Worthington <kworthington at gmail dot com> - 0.6.32-win32
- 0.6.32 release of nginx for Windows. Built on Windows Vista Ultimate 32-bit.
- Tested and known to work on Windows 2000 Professional and Windows XP Professional.

 

下载(840K):fs2you | 来自软件生活 | 纳米盘 | live-share | ziddu | divshare | easy-share

PS:想知道网站是用什么服务器的吗?用Http/Https Protocol Debugger查看头部信息吧。

Popularity: 2%

可能还感兴趣

“HTTP服务器 Nginx 的 Windows 版”有 23 个评论

» 欢迎发表评论发送Trackback

  1. ZH CEXO

    沙发沙发~~~
    我先用的是XAMPP,后来改成了WAMP,现在又想试试EASYPHP了,呵呵!

    回复

    Black-Xstar2008-07-31 6:58 下午 回复:

    本地调试我用XAMPP的。

    回复

    ZH CEXO2008-07-31 7:41 下午 回复:

    功能都大同小异,也没太执着用哪一个,呵呵,都差不多,核心是一样的嘛。

    回复

    jyfish2008-08-02 11:05 上午 回复:

    XAMPP 😈

    回复

  2. Yacca

    你边上的li 小标签真可爱...哈哈

    回复

    Black-Xstar2008-07-31 6:59 下午 回复:

    大叔想说什么呢?

    回复

    Lucifr2008-07-31 11:19 下午 回复:

    大叔在夸你边栏里列表前的图标

    回复

  3. 小墨

    我本地测试用的WampServer
    感觉非常好用。。呵呵

    回复

    Black-Xstar2008-07-31 7:01 下午 回复:

    貌似小墨没理解我的意思。
    nginx不直接支持脚本的。

    回复

    小墨2008-07-31 8:55 下午 回复:

    额……那还要做很多配置?
    貌似有点麻烦

    回复

    ZH CEXO2008-07-31 7:42 下午 回复:

    握个手先……我用的也是这个!

    回复

  4. Charles

    好高深啊,一般来说,产生不了那个需求啊,用用apache足够了

    回复

  5. Lucifr

    又是比较专业的应用,lucifr应该用不到

    回复

  6. 别用鼠标点我

    感觉还是在linux下弄比较好~可以避免许多麻烦~~

    回复

  7. zicjin

    我下的Development 版本,登录http://127.0.0.1的时候提示要用户名密码,是啥?

    回复

    Black-Xstar2008-12-02 9:04 上午 回复:

    @zicjin, 看看配置文件或者说明吧。

    回复

  8. 清晨迷雾

    正在查阅相关资料,谢谢

    清晨迷雾

    回复

  9. hqhe

    features:
    *) native porting of nginx on windows.
    *) single process mode.
    *) windows service supported.
    *) iocp event method.
    *) file aio.
    *) TransmitPackets, TransmitFile.
    *) zlib-1.2.3. (statically link)
    *) pcre-7.9. (statically link)
    *) openssl-0.9.8o. (statically link)
    *) using configure to build the binary with mingw+vc10.

    download:
    *) http://www.ngwsx.org/download
    *) http://github.com/hehaiqiang/ngwsx/downloads

    回复

  10. ngwsx

    Ngwsx是Nginx的一个非官方的Windows移植版本,使用Windows的IOCP,支持高并发。

    特性:

    *) 支持IOCP和Select两种IO模型。

    *) 支持以Windows服务的方式运行。

    *) 支持单进程和主从进程(主进程/工作进程)两种工作模式,

    启用IOCP事件模块只支持单个工作进程,启用Select事件模块可支持多个工作进程。

    *) 使用AcceptEx和ConnectEx等WinSock扩展函数。

    *) 静态链接PCRE和ZLIB库。

    下载:

    https://github.com/downloads/hehaiqiang/ngwsx/nginx-1.0.4.0.rar

    ==========================================================

    ngx_php_module是一个nginx http模块,它把php解析器内嵌到nginx里面用来执行php脚本。

    特性:

    *) PHP解析器内嵌到Nginx,类似于Apache httpd的mod_php模块。

    下载:

    https://github.com/downloads/hehaiqiang/ngwsx/ngx_php-1.0.4.0.rar

    回复

» Trackbacks/Pingbacks

  1. waakee.com (Trackback, 2008-07-31 )

    HTTP服务器 Nginx 的 Windows 版 | 软件生活...

    一般来说,最常见的HTTP服务器有IIS和Apache,例如软件生活用的LAMP服务器其实就是Linux+Apache+Mysql+PHP的缩写。除此之外,还有很多轻量的HTTP服务器软件。
    简单地说,和上面的两个相比,这些服...

  2. HTTP服务器 Nginx 的 Windows 版 « Leo Cai (Pingback, 2009-03-19 )

    [...] HTTP服务器 Nginx 的 Windows 版 [...]

  3. » HTTP服务器 Nginx 的 Windows 版 电子商务创业思考与实践分享 读思客 (Pingback, 2009-04-30 )

    [...] HTTP服务器 Nginx 的 Windows 版 三月 15th, 2009 in 默认分类 [...]

发表评论